How Each State Is Affected By E-Commerce Scams

While economies the world over suffered, slowed, and effectively stopped due to the pandemic, the fraud economy flourished. 

Experts estimated that the annual global cost of fraud in 2020 would total just over $5 trillion USD—more than the GDP of most countries. 

Those were pre-pandemic estimates, derived under pre-pandemic conditions and an old normal. 

Experts believe the actual total in our new covid-concurrent reality is much higher. In some areas around the world, rates of fraud rose by nearly 20%. 

The fraud economy, like any other, is vast, complex, and full of skilled operators who drive it. Cybercrime is a major contributor to the fraud economy, with e-commerce fraud as an offshoot.
